Senses

жизнерадостный is used for these senses in English:

  • blithe (chiefly, Scotland, elsewhere, _, dated, or, literary) Cheerful, happy.
  • buoyant (figuratively) Lighthearted and lively.
  • gay (dated) Happy, joyful, and lively.
  • high-spirited Possessing a bold nature.
  • sanguine Anticipating the best; optimistic; confident; full of hope. [from early 16th c.]
  • upbeat Having a positive, lively, or perky tone, attitude, etc.
  • vivacious Lively and animated; full of life and energy.
  • zestful (figurative) Having a spirited love of life; ebullient, zesty.
